drjobs Senior Software EngineerRoku Player SDk- International Service Provider

Senior Software EngineerRoku Player SDk- International Service Provider

Employer Active

1 Vacancy
drjobs

Job Alert

You will be updated with latest job alerts via email
Valid email field required
Send jobs
Send me jobs like this
drjobs

Job Alert

You will be updated with latest job alerts via email

Valid email field required
Send jobs
Job Location drjobs

Mumbai - India

Monthly Salary drjobs

Not Disclosed

drjobs

Salary Not Disclosed

Vacancy

1 Vacancy

Job Description

 Job description The Job Warner Bros Discovery WBD is seeking a skilled Software Development Engineer II to join our Roku Player SDK Team This team is responsible for developing and optimizing video playback experiences across Roku platforms ensuring high quality seamless streaming experiences for millions of users worldwide including on our flagship streaming service Max You will work within a growing team of talented engineers across the globe dedicated to innovation in streaming technology for Roku devices As a Software Development Engineer II you will contribute to the delivery of new video playback related features for the Roku platform across the WBD streaming app suite You will be expected to ensure these features are delivered with good quality and in a timely manner You will work closely with other engineers and your manager to contribute to the planning of future sprints for new Roku specific features and bug fixes To be successful in this position you should have a solid track record of building high performance applications for Roku and a good understanding of Software Architecture and Design principles within the Roku ecosystem You should be comfortable using common industry tools for software development including IDEs build and continuous integration systems source code control management and code review tools with a focus on the Roku development environment You will contribute to the design and implementation of high quality Roku applications while working within a professional team environment You should be an effective communicator and be able to author clear technical documentation describing approaches to solving problems on the Roku platform including Brightscript specific considerations The Daily
  •  Design develop and maintain components of the Roku Player SDK for various Roku devices
  •  Collaborate with crossfunctional teams including product managers designers and other engineering teams to enhance the video playback experience on Roku
  •  Contribute to the optimization of streaming performance on Roku devices ensuring low latency high quality and smooth playback utilizing the Roku Media Player
  •  Assist in troubleshooting and resolving technical issues related to media streaming buffering and DRM specifically on the Roku platform and within Brightscript
  •  Ensure code quality through unit testing integration testing and participation in code reviews with a focus on Brightscript and Rokuspecific testing methodologies
  •  Stay up to date with Rokus latest technologies and industry best practices to contribute to the SDKs evolution on the Roku platform
  •  Work across teams and disciplines to explore and document technical solutions for Roku contributing to the evaluation of technical tradeoffs using the latest streaming media technologies and video capabilities within the Roku environment
 The Essentials
  •  3 years of software development experience with a significant focus on Roku development using Brightscript
  •  Strong proficiency in Brightscript and experience with the Roku SDK and Roku Media Player
  •  A bachelors degree in Computer Science Engineering or equivalent work experience
  •  Solid problemsolving skills and the ability to debug moderately complex issues on the Roku platform including Brightscript debugging
  •  Familiarity with CICD pipelines automated testing concepts and Agile development methodologies within the context of Roku development
  •  Good written and verbal communication skills and the ability to work collaboratively in a fastpaced environment including discussing Rokuspecific challenges and solutions
  •  Experience with the architecture design and implementation of moderately complex Roku applications with an understanding of scalability testability and performance tuning on Roku devices
  •  Familiarity with scripting languages commonly used in conjunction with Roku development
  •  Willingness to participate in periodic oncall support for critical emergent customerfacing issues on Roku with guidance
  •  Ability to provide guidance and mentorship to more junior engineers on the team regarding Roku development best practices and Brightscript
  •  Previous experience working with video playback on Roku devices
  •  Familiarity with video analytics and telemetry concepts as they relate to Roku applications
 The Nice to Haves
  •  Good understanding of video streaming protocols eg HLS DASH and their implementation on Roku
  •  Experience with DRM technologies eg PlayReady integration on the Roku platform
  •  Experience with user interface development using the Roku SceneGraph framework
  •  Familiarity with Roku deployment processes and channel certification

Roku,SDK,Brightscript,scenegraph

Employment Type

Full Time

Company Industry

Report This Job
Disclaimer: Drjobpro.com is only a platform that connects job seekers and employers. Applicants are advised to conduct their own independent research into the credentials of the prospective employer.We always make certain that our clients do not endorse any request for money payments, thus we advise against sharing any personal or bank-related information with any third party. If you suspect fraud or malpractice, please contact us via contact us page.